Mississippi became the 20th state admitted to the Union on December 10, 1817.

What was the first state west of the Mississippi River admitted to the Union?

The first state west of the Mississippi River to be admitted to the Union was Missouri. It became the 24th state on August 10, 1821, following the Missouri Compromise, which allowed for its admission as a slave state while maintaining a balance with free states. Missouri's admission marked a significant moment in the expansion of the United States westward.
